Kyoto Golf Courses - Can you help me decide? by Nexen1987 in Kyoto

[–]ajpainter24 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I used to play Kyoto Ohara a lot with my son, and I have lots of fond memories of the place. In March the grass will be brown, like even the good courses in Japan. Ohara is a typical tight, hilly, narrow golf course so don’t expect pebble beach. The staff are always nice and the vibe is relaxed, which is not always the case in Japan. Perhaps the best thing of all about Ohara is that it is very near to Sanzen-in temple, one of my favorites and a must see destination. The village of Ohara is also famous for its pickles, which are awesome.
